I enjoyed a pleasant'ish lunch here today. Service was friendly but unfortunately, our waiter got the order wrong which meant one of us had to start eating lest our food get cold.

We asked for bread and olive oil to start but were not given side plates. Despite our best efforts, we had oil dripping everywhere and bizarrely, had to ask for them. Every part of both our meals was salty - veg, fish, chicken. The only respite were the fries with no salt! What a relief! The food presentation was basic & rather sloppy. No excitement on that plate!

The bill was โ‚ฌ22 and โ‚ฌ30 was given. They said "thank you" and proceeded to take the money. They said "everything ok yes?!" To which I replied yes. Then I stood there and they held tightly to the money. I ruffled some items around in my bag to kill time but there was never a polite mention of "here is your change" for me to decide if I wanted to leave an โ‚ฌ8 tip for sub par food!

Overall OK...a rather generous OK. Suffice to say I definitely won't be eating...

This restaurant was the favorite for many people on the Portugal trip. A friend had been here before and raved about the octopus, so we had high expectations (that were met). Our group of 8 swung by around 7pm on a Wednesday evening. The restaurant is too small to seat 8, so we split into two groups of 4. The first group was able to be seated immediately; the second group needed to wait about 10 minutes. - Mixed salad, 5 Euros. Nice big bowl of mixed greens, shredded carrots, tomato wedges, and sliced onions. They give you bottles of olive oil and vinegar. - Grilled sardines, 16 Euros. Comes with 4 sardines and vegetables. I didn't eat the sardines (I think small fish are too much work), but the vegetables were so tasty. - Octopus with garlic & olive oil, 21 Euros. SENSATIONAL. This lived up to the hype. Most octopus I've had is tough, but this full octopus is tender from mid-body all the way to the tentacles. - Fish of the day, 19 Euros. Our fish was the sea bass. Tender and flaky. - Grilled salmon, 16.50 Euros. Juicy, with delectably seared skin. - Bolo bolacha (biscuit cake), 5 Euros. This was advertised to us as a Portugese tiramisu. The coffee flavor is not as strong, the cake is not as soaked, and there's less whipped cream, all of which I liked! - Red fruits cheesecake, 5 Euros. The filling is whipped and creamy, not dense like a NY style cheesecake. Delicious. Ask for their piri piri sauce. It burns immediately, and it's delightful. Our server was delightful. Card accepted. Get the octopus, fish, and bolo bolacha!

Chanced upon this small, cozy restaurant in Lisbon. Ordered the house special steaks, grilled sardines and of course, the popular octopus. Steaks doneness were just nice and it came with fries that were double fried as well as some rice. Rice was a little underwhelming and didn't seem to go well with the steak probably because I'm Asian, maybe could have just served it with the fries. Steaks were very tasty, juicy and well seasoned. Octopus was delightful. Flavorful, fresh and of a relatively large portion size, just that it was served with a bit more olive oil than expected. Server was very good with the orders, very responsive and helpful as well! On a side note, was introduced to Sagres Bohemia Original. Had it with the steak, the octopus as well as the sardines, and it went so well with all of them.

Service was not the best . We were served by two different servers , our main server seemed to served us with a judgemental vibe , we felt uncomfortable after saying no to Bread & Cheese & requested for Tap Water . However glad they still served us our food . One of the dishes we ordered had a rotten potato . We gave a feedback but no apology was given by 2nd server and he replied its common. So guys , if you have a rotten root vegetable on your plate its "normal" . To be fair the Octopus was cooked well but the Codfish was overcooked. The space is ultra tight . If you a claustrophobic , tall or big built , be prepared to squeeze in. Also a note the management saw my post and apologized. However I hope things will get better not just in this restaurant but generically across Portugal.
